02: BEST TIME TO ELOPE IN CALIFORNIA

When to Elope in California

California is big — and the best season depends on where you’re going.

🌱 Spring (March–May)

Vibe: Wildflowers, waterfalls, green hills
Best for: Big Sur, Yosemite Valley, desert blooms
Top Spots: Carrizo Plain, Joshua Tree, Mendocino, Eastern Sierra
✔️ Pros: Mild temps, lush views
❌ Cons: Snow may still block high-elevation roads


☀️ Summer (June–August)

Vibe: Blue skies, dry trails, adventure-ready
Best for: High Sierra hikes, Lake Tahoe, NorCal coast
Top Spots: Yosemite high country, Mount Shasta, Mammoth Lakes
✔️ Pros: Epic visibility, long days
❌ Cons: Desert heat, crowded national parks


🍂 Fall (September–October)

Vibe: Golden tones, quieter parks, dreamy light
Best for: Wine country, Big Sur, redwoods
Top Spots: Napa Valley, Santa Cruz Mountains, Sequoia National Park
✔️ Pros: Crisp air, colorful foliage
❌ Cons: Wildfire risk in some areas


❄️ Winter (November–February)

Vibe: Snowy mountains, stormy coastlines, moody forests
Best for: Joshua Tree, Death Valley, cozy cabins
Top Spots: Eastern Sierra, California desert parks, Redwood National Park
✔️ Pros: Fewer tourists, magical moods
❌ Cons: Winter storms, limited mountain access

Time of Day Tips

  • Sunrise Elopements – Best for Yosemite, deserts, and popular overlooks
  • Sunset Elopements – Prime time for coastal ceremonies and golden hour portraits
  • Weekday Elopements – Way fewer crowds, especially in national parks and coastal spots

Do You Need a Permit?

Yes — most of the time.

You’ll likely need one if you’re eloping on:

  • National park land (Yosemite, Joshua Tree, etc.)
  • California state parks
  • Coastal or conservation lands

GETTING LEGALLY MARRIED IN CALIFORNIA

  • Apply in person at any County Clerk’s office (no residency requirement)
  • No waiting period — get married the same day
  • License valid for 90 days
  • One witness required (two max)
